/* Static routes, multicast routing using cand-bsr and cand-rp. * Think of 'rddVRX' as ethernet interfaces. rddVR3 is connected * to rddVR2 on the other router. */ interfaces { interface "rddVR3" { vif "rddVR3" { address 2.1.1.2 { prefix-length: 24 } } } interface "rddVR6" { vif "rddVR6" { address 3.1.1.1 { prefix-length: 24 } } } } fea { unicast-forwarding4 { disable: false /* table-id: 10002 */ } } protocols { static { route 5.1.1.0/24 { next-hop: 2.1.1.1 } } fib2mrib { disable: false } igmp { disable: false interface "rddVR3" { vif "rddVR3" { disable: false version: 2 enable-ip-router-alert-option-check: false query-interval: 125 query-last-member-interval: 1 query-response-interval: 10 robust-count: 2 } } interface "rddVR6" { vif "rddVR6" { disable: false version: 2 enable-ip-router-alert-option-check: false query-interval: 125 query-last-member-interval: 1 query-response-interval: 10 robust-count: 2 } } } /* igmp */ pimsm4 { disable: false interface "rddVR3" { vif "rddVR3" { disable: false dr-priority: 125 hello-period: 30 hello-triggered-delay: 5 } } interface "rddVR6" { vif "rddVR6" { disable: false dr-priority: 125 hello-period: 30 hello-triggered-delay: 5 } } interface "register_vif" { vif "register_vif" { disable: false dr-priority: 1 hello-period: 30 hello-triggered-delay: 5 } } bootstrap { disable: false cand-bsr { scope-zone 224.0.0.0/4 { is-scope-zone: false cand-bsr-by-vif-name: "rddVR3" bsr-priority: 198 } } cand-rp { group-prefix 224.0.0.0/4 { is-scope-zone: false cand-rp-by-vif-name: "rddVR3" rp-priority: 102 rp-holdtime: 150 } } } /* bootstrap */ switch-to-spt-threshold { disable: false interval: 100 bytes: 1024000 } } /* pimsm4 */ } /* protocols */ plumbing { mfea4 { disable: false interface "rddVR3" { vif "rddVR3" { disable: false } } interface "rddVR6" { vif "rddVR6" { disable: false } } interface "register_vif" { vif "register_vif" { disable: false } } } /* mfea4 */ } /* plumbing */ /* End of Config File */